Top Mistakes to Avoid When Implementing Legal Case Management Software

In today’s digital-first legal environment, more firms and in-house legal teams are turning to legal case management software to streamline operations, reduce administrative burdens, and improve client service. But while the benefits are significant, implementation is where many legal teams falter. Rushed decisions, lack of training, and poor planning can lead to costly setbacks and underutilized systems. To help you succeed, we’ve outlined the top mistakes to avoid when implementing legal case management software—and how to get it right from day one.

Skipping the Needs Assessment Phase

One of the most common pitfalls is jumping into a solution without fully understanding your firm’s or legal department’s unique requirements.

Avoid this by:

  • Mapping out current challenges and inefficiencies.
  • Identifying must-have features (e.g., document automation, task tracking, secure storage).
  • Consulting all stakeholders—from attorneys to paralegals—for input.

A thoughtful needs assessment helps you choose the right solution tailored to your practice.

Choosing a One-Size-Fits-All Platform

Not all legal case management systems are built the same. A solution designed for large law firms may not suit small legal teams—or vice versa.

Watch out for:

  • Software that lacks customization.
  • Complex interfaces that slow down smaller teams.
  • Tools that don’t scale with your growth.

Always opt for platforms that are flexible and adaptable to your practice size and area of law.

Neglecting User Training and Onboarding

Even the most powerful software is useless if your team doesn’t know how to use it effectively. Many firms underestimate the importance of training during implementation.

Best practices include:

  • Scheduling hands-on training sessions.
  • Creating user guides tailored to your workflows.
  • Offering ongoing support for new users.

Well-trained staff will adopt the system faster and with more confidence.

Failing to Migrate Data Properly

Poor data migration can lead to missing case files, lost client history, or even compliance issues. This step requires careful planning and execution.

To avoid this:

  • Back up all existing data before migration.
  • Work with your software vendor on a clear data transfer process.
  • Verify data integrity post-migration.

Clean, organized data ensures your system starts on a strong foundation.

Overlooking Integration and Compatibility

A legal case management system should work seamlessly with your existing tools—like email, billing software, or document storage platforms.

Check for:

  • Compatibility with Microsoft Office, Outlook, or GSuite.
  • Integration with billing, CRM, and e-signature tools.
  • API support for future scalability.

Seamless integration boosts efficiency and eliminates redundant tasks.
